What are the primary drivers fueling the growth of the asparaginase for injection market in recent years?
The rising incidence of leukemia is expected to propel the growth of the asparaginase for injection market in the coming years. Leukemia is a cancer that starts in the blood-forming tissues, including the bone marrow, causing the uncontrolled production of abnormal white blood cells. The incidence of leukemia is increasing globally, leading to a growing number of diagnosed cases each year. This rise reflects a broader trend in the overall burden of cancer, with leukemia becoming more commonly identified across various age groups. Asparaginase for injection is used to treat leukemia by depleting asparagine, an amino acid that leukemia cells cannot produce on their own, thereby starving them and inhibiting their growth. For instance, in March 2025, according to a report published by the American Cancer Society, a US-based non-profit organization, approximately 22,010 people are expected to be diagnosed with acute myeloid leukemia (AML) in the United States, with the majority being adults. Additionally, around 11,090 deaths from AML are projected, and most of these will also occur in adults. Therefore, the rising incidence of leukemia will drive the growth of the asparaginase for injection market.

Major companies in the asparaginase for injection market are focusing on developing technologically advanced products, such as recombinant medications, to treat patients with acute lymphoblastic leukemia (ALL) and lymphoblastic lymphoma (LBL). Recombinant medications are drugs made using genetically engineered organisms to produce therapeutic proteins or hormones that mimic natural human substances. For instance, in July 2023, Jazz Pharmaceuticals, an Ireland-based biopharmaceutical company, received the European Medicines Agency’s Committee for Medicinal Products for Human Use (CHMP) approval for JZP458 (recombinant Erwinia asparaginase, or crisantaspase). This treatment is approved as part of a multi-agent chemotherapy regimen for ALL patients with hypersensitivity to E. coli-derived asparaginase, providing an alternative for about 30% of patients who struggle with traditional therapies. Clinical trials show that JZP458 maintains vital serum asparaginase activity, supporting its role in treatment.

How is the asparaginase for injection market defined, and what are its core characteristics?
Asparaginase for injection is an enzyme-based medication used primarily in the treatment of acute lymphoblastic leukemia (ALL) and other cancers. It functions by depleting asparagine, an amino acid crucial for the growth and survival of cancer cells, thereby preventing their proliferation. The drug is typically derived from bacteria such as escherichia coli or erwinia chrysanthemi and is administered through injection.
